Game Testing Service Market: Strategic Imperatives for 2026 — A PW Consulting Executive Brief

Executive summary

PW Consulting’s latest Game Testing Service Market report (base year 2025) surfaces the structural shifts and tactical choices that will determine winners and losers as publishers, platform holders, and service providers adapt to an accelerated, compliance-intensive, and AI-enabled production environment. The market has expanded markedly over the past half-decade — from USD 2,642.18 Million in 2020 to USD 4,452.23 Million in 2025 — and is forecast to continue robust growth, reaching approximately USD 4,984.85 Million in 2026 and USD 9,214.44 Million by 2032 at a 10.95% CAGR across the 2026–2032 forecast window. Market trajectory and strategic implications for 2026

The market trajectory is not merely a historical artifact; it is a signal about where operational risk, unit economics, and opportunity converge. A near-doubling of market value across the forecast period is being driven by three convergent forces: rising complexity of multi-platform releases, regulatory and platform certification burdens, and rapid adoption of automated and AI-assisted testing methods. These pressures amplify both demand for specialist service providers and the value of vertically integrated testing-capability stacks that can deliver compliance, performance, and localization at scale.

For 2026 budgeting cycles, this growth profile validates increased allocation to the following line items: device-lab expansion or external device-lab partnerships, investment in AI-assisted test automation, contract re-design to address liability and data-handling for regulated markets, and contingency budgets for accelerated certification cycles tied to new platform launches (cloud/VR/AR). Executives who treat testing as discretionary will find themselves exposed to release delays and certification rework; those who treat it as core risk mitigation will see faster time-to-revenue and lower post-launch hotfix costs.

Forces reshaping the game testing landscape

  • AI and automation:

    AI-assisted testing is moving from pilot projects to production. Vendors are releasing platforms that promise meaningful reductions in regression-cycle time and reproducibility of elusive gameplay bugs. However, adopting AI requires calibrated investment — tooling plus people and governance — to realize ROI without amplifying false positives or compliance gaps.

  • Regulatory and platform compliance:

    Heightened regulatory scrutiny around data privacy, monetization mechanics, and child protection is expanding the scope of testing to include legal and policy verification. Certification requirements from platform owners now form a predictable gating item in release planning, making pre-cert testing and formal compliance QA indispensable.

  • Device and platform fragmentation:

    Mobile device diversity, cloud streaming permutations, and emergent AR/VR hardware create a combinatorial explosion in compatibility matrices. This drives demand for optimized device-pool strategies and cost models that balance coverage against run-time economics.

  • Outsourcing economics and labor arbitrage:

    Outsourcing remains a powerful lever: shifting testing and engineering tasks to lower-cost geographies can reduce labor spend substantially. But cost-savings are only one vector; quality, IP protection, and scale are equally important when selecting partners.

Competitive landscape: what to watch in 2026

The ecosystem of providers shows clear stratification between global integrators, regional specialists, and niche boutiques. PW Consulting’s report profiles each player with operational KPIs, capability maps, and scenario-based vendor fit for different studio archetypes. Below are distilled, decision-focused observations about prominent vendors.

  • Keywords Studios (Dublin) — The largest dedicated gaming services provider has doubled down on scale and automation. Recent product launches emphasize AI-assisted test orchestration intended to reduce regression time and integrate with publisher pipelines. Strategic takeaway: ideal partner for publishers seeking global studio capacity combined with platform-grade process controls; cost-premium justified by scale and integrator risk reduction.
  • Lionbridge Games (global operations) — Strong in linguistic QA, localization QA, and compliance readiness for mass-market launches. Strategic takeaway: best-in-class for publishers prioritizing rapid, regionally-compliant launches where language quality and culturally-sensitive testing are mission-critical.
  • Testronic Labs (Los Angeles/Europe) — Deep expertise in certification and performance testing across platforms. Strategic takeaway: recommended for titles that require meticulous certification support and high-fidelity performance profiling prior to release.
  • Pole To Win / SIDE (Marina del Rey) — Offers QA combined with full co-development services (art, audio, codevelopment). Strategic takeaway: attractive when studios seek a single vendor to absorb multiple development and QA functions, accelerating timelines at the cost of vendor concentration.
  • Smaller specialist providers (e.g., Quantic Lab, GlobalStep, iXie Gaming, QATestLab, TestFort, QAble, KiwiQA, TestMatick, SnoopGame, LogiGear) — These firms present differentiated value through device-lab depth, region-specific talent pools, or price-competitive models. Strategic takeaway: high upside for targeted engagement (e.g., device compatibility sweeps, mobile-first QA, performance tuning) and for studios employing modular outsourcing strategies.

Recent market moves — from platform launches of AI-assisted tooling to alliances that deepen automated testing methodologies — underscore a bifurcation: providers that invest early in tooling and integration will capture more strategic engagements, while those betting only on low-cost delivery will remain in a commoditized segment.

Operational playbook: using the report to make 2026 decisions

We designed the report to be executable by procurement teams, product leads, and corporate development heads. The following condensed playbook highlights the near-term steps that informed executives should take in 2026:

  • Vendor selection and engagement model:

    Adopt a two-tier engagement: (1) strategic partnerships with 1–2 global integrators for certification, localization, and peak-load capacity; (2) a roster of vetted niche providers for targeted technical work. Use scorecards that weigh automation capability, data governance, and platform-cert expertise ahead of simple hourly rates.

  • Build vs. buy analysis for automation:

    Run a 12–18 month ROI model on AI-assisted automation vs. commercial platforms factoring in reduced regression cycles, cost of false positives, and maintenance. Our report includes a customizable ROI template to quantify the trade-offs against internal engineering priorities.

  • Contract design and risk allocation:

    Insist on SLAs that are outcome-based (e.g., certification pass-rates, defect escape windows) and embed data-handling and IP clauses aligned with regional regulatory regimes. Budget for third-party audits of vendor security controls when handling EU or US consumer data.

  • Device-lab optimization:

    Shift from exhaustive device matrices to a risk-weighted device-pool strategy informed by telemetry and player demographics. The report supplies a calculator to size device pools and estimate incremental testing costs across device coverage scenarios.

  • M&A and strategic partnerships:

    Use M&A to accelerate capability acquisition (AI tooling, device-lab presence, or localization depth) rather than relying purely on internal build-up. Our deal-screening framework prioritizes targets by capability gaps, integration complexity, and accretive revenue potential.
